Types of Flight Bags: Choosing the Right One for Your Needs
The market offers a diverse range of flight bags, each designed with specific features and intended for different types of pilots and flight operations. Understanding the various categories can significantly streamline the selection process and ensure you acquire a bag that perfectly aligns with your individual requirements. Consider the size and configuration of your aircraft, the typical duration of your flights, and the instruments and materials you routinely carry. A small training aircraft might only necessitate a compact bag for essential charts and a headset, while a larger, more complex aircraft might demand a larger bag with multiple compartments for EFBs, spare batteries, and maintenance logs.
One common categorization is based on size and carrying style. Small flight bags, often resembling oversized purses or briefcases, are ideal for pilots who prioritize portability and minimal gear. These bags typically accommodate a headset, a kneeboard, a flight computer, and a few essential charts. Medium-sized bags offer a greater capacity, often featuring dedicated compartments for tablets, radios, and larger charts. These bags are a versatile option for pilots who need to carry a more comprehensive set of equipment without sacrificing too much portability. Large flight bags, resembling rolling suitcases or duffel bags, are designed for pilots who require substantial storage space. These bags are well-suited for long-distance flights, multiple-day trips, or pilots who carry a significant amount of electronic equipment and spare parts.
Another important distinction lies in the bag’s construction material and level of protection. Some flight bags are crafted from durable nylon or canvas, offering a balance between affordability and resilience. These materials are typically water-resistant and can withstand the rigors of frequent use. Premium flight bags often utilize leather or ballistic nylon, providing enhanced durability, water resistance, and a more professional aesthetic. These materials are more expensive but offer superior protection for sensitive electronic equipment and are more likely to withstand the test of time. Consider the typical weather conditions you fly in and the level of protection your equipment requires when choosing a bag material.
Finally, the internal organization of a flight bag is crucial for efficiency and accessibility. Look for bags with multiple compartments, dividers, and pockets to keep your equipment organized and easily accessible during flight. Dedicated headset compartments, padded tablet sleeves, and quick-access pockets for charts and pens are particularly valuable features. Consider the specific items you carry and how you prefer to organize them when evaluating the internal layout of a flight bag. A well-organized bag not only enhances efficiency but also contributes to a safer and more stress-free flying experience.

Maintaining and Caring for Your Flight Bag
Proper maintenance and care are essential for extending the lifespan of your flight bag and ensuring it remains a reliable companion for years to come. Neglecting maintenance can lead to premature wear and tear, damage to your equipment, and ultimately the need for a replacement. Regular cleaning, proper storage, and prompt repairs are crucial for preserving the bag’s functionality and appearance.
Regular cleaning is the foundation of flight bag maintenance. Dust, dirt, and debris can accumulate over time, leading to discoloration and damage to the bag’s material. Use a soft brush or vacuum cleaner to remove loose debris from the interior and exterior of the bag. For more stubborn stains or dirt, use a damp cloth with mild soap to gently clean the affected areas. Avoid using harsh chemicals or abrasive cleaners, as these can damage the fabric and zippers. Allow the bag to air dry completely before storing it to prevent mildew or mold growth.
Proper storage is equally important for preventing damage and maintaining the bag’s shape. When not in use, store the bag in a cool, dry place away from direct sunlight and extreme temperatures. Avoid storing the bag in cramped or confined spaces, as this can lead to compression and deformation. If possible, fill the bag with soft materials, such as packing paper or towels, to help maintain its shape. Consider using a dust cover to protect the bag from dust and scratches.
Prompt repairs are crucial for addressing minor damages before they escalate into more significant problems. Regularly inspect the bag for tears, rips, or loose stitching. Repair minor tears or rips with a needle and thread or a fabric adhesive. Replace damaged zippers or buckles as soon as possible to prevent further damage to the bag. Addressing these issues promptly can prevent them from becoming more costly and time-consuming repairs in the future.
Finally, consider the specific care instructions provided by the manufacturer. Some flight bags may require special cleaning or maintenance procedures due to the specific materials used in their construction. Refer to the manufacturer’s instructions for guidance on cleaning, storage, and repairs. Following these instructions can help ensure that you are properly caring for your flight bag and maximizing its lifespan.
Flight Bag Alternatives: Exploring Other Options for Pilots
While dedicated flight bags are a popular and often ideal choice for pilots, alternative options exist that may better suit specific needs or preferences. These alternatives range from repurposed bags to specialized organizational systems, offering varying degrees of functionality, portability, and cost-effectiveness. Exploring these options can help pilots make informed decisions and find solutions that perfectly align with their individual flying styles.
One common alternative is using a standard backpack or duffel bag. These bags offer a versatile and affordable option for pilots who do not require the specialized features of a dedicated flight bag. Backpacks can provide comfortable carrying options, especially for longer walks to the aircraft, while duffel bags offer ample storage space for larger items. However, these bags typically lack dedicated compartments for aviation-specific equipment, such as headsets, charts, and tablets, which can make organization more challenging.
Another alternative is utilizing a modular organizational system within an existing bag. These systems typically consist of various pouches, dividers, and organizers that can be customized to fit specific equipment. This approach allows pilots to adapt their existing bags to better accommodate their aviation needs without investing in a new dedicated flight bag. Modular systems can be particularly useful for pilots who already own a high-quality backpack or duffel bag and want to enhance its functionality.
Briefcases or laptop bags can also serve as a viable alternative for pilots who primarily carry electronic flight bags (EFBs) and minimal paper charts. These bags are typically compact and professional-looking, making them well-suited for pilots who prioritize portability and a streamlined appearance. However, they often lack the storage capacity and organizational features necessary for carrying larger headsets or extensive paper charts.
Finally, some pilots opt for specialized storage solutions within the aircraft itself. This approach involves installing custom compartments or organizers in the cockpit to hold essential equipment. This can be a particularly useful option for pilots who primarily fly the same aircraft and want to maximize space and efficiency. However, this approach requires careful planning and installation to ensure that the storage solutions are secure and do not interfere with the aircraft’s operation. While this isn’t exactly a flight bag alternative, it does negate the need to lug a flight bag from the car to the cockpit.

Size and Compliance with Regulations
The size and dimensions of a flight bag are critical considerations, not only for ensuring adequate storage capacity but also for complying with airline carry-on regulations. Exceeding size restrictions can result in gate-checking fees, delays, and inconvenience. Pilots who frequently fly commercially, either as airline crew or when commuting to flight training, must carefully consider the bag’s dimensions to ensure it meets the maximum carry-on size limitations imposed by different airlines. A flight bag that can comfortably fit under the seat or in the overhead compartment is essential for avoiding these issues.
Data from major airlines indicates that the maximum carry-on size typically ranges from 22 x 14 x 9 inches to 24 x 16 x 10 inches, although these dimensions can vary slightly depending on the airline and aircraft type. It’s crucial to verify the specific regulations of the airlines that are frequently used. Moreover, the weight of the flight bag, even if within size limitations, can also be a factor, as some airlines impose weight restrictions on carry-on baggage. Selecting a flight bag that is lightweight yet durable allows pilots to maximize the amount of equipment they can carry without exceeding weight limits. Adhering to airline regulations not only prevents additional fees and delays but also contributes to a smoother and more stress-free travel experience for pilots.

What are the pros and cons of a traditional flight bag versus a more modern backpack style?
Traditional flight bags typically feature a rectangular or duffel bag shape with a single large compartment and a few smaller pockets. The primary advantage of this style is ease of access to the main compartment. You can quickly locate items without having to rummage through multiple layers of pockets. However, traditional flight bags often lack specialized compartments, making it difficult to keep everything organized and secure. They also tend to be less comfortable to carry for extended periods, especially when heavily loaded.
Backpack-style flight bags offer improved weight distribution and comfort due to their ergonomic design and padded shoulder straps. They often incorporate multiple compartments and pockets designed for specific items, such as headsets, charts, and electronic devices, allowing for superior organization. However, backpacks can be more cumbersome to access in the cockpit, as you may need to remove the bag entirely to retrieve an item. The choice between a traditional flight bag and a backpack depends on individual preferences and the specific needs of the pilot. Pilots who prioritize easy access may prefer a traditional bag, while those who value organization and comfort may opt for a backpack.

How much should I expect to spend on a good quality flight bag?
The price of a good quality flight bag can vary significantly depending on the brand, materials, features, and size. Generally, you can expect to spend anywhere from $50 to $300 or more. Bags in the lower price range ($50-$100) typically offer basic functionality and are suitable for pilots who only need to carry a minimal amount of equipment. These bags may lack specialized compartments, durable materials, and robust construction.
Mid-range flight bags ($100-$200) often offer a better balance of features and quality. They typically include dedicated compartments for headsets, charts, and electronic devices, as well as more durable materials like ballistic nylon or reinforced canvas. High-end flight bags ($200+) are designed for professional pilots who demand the highest level of durability, organization, and comfort. These bags often feature premium materials, reinforced construction, and a wide range of specialized features. While the initial investment may be higher, a high-quality flight bag can provide years of reliable service and potentially save you money in the long run by protecting your valuable equipment.
